Really looking forward to the GP on Saturday in Torun.

Yes their still is a chance for KK to overall Greg so a lot of interest there.

BUT I think the fight for top 8 places will prove very interesting. There are 4 riders racing on Saturday going for place 7 and 8 so racing there should be some serious racing..

And of course a battle of pride lower down between Chris Harris (regular gp rider) only 2 points ahead of part-time gp rider MJJ - just 2 point between them.

Should all be good stuff come Saturday.

Looks like Gniezno (90 mins. from Torun) have decided to run a meeting on the day of the GP starting at 4pm!!!

 

According to Spotowefakty:-

 

11 października na torze w Gnieźnie odbędzie się turniej, który zakończy sezon żużlowy w tym mieście. W imprezie wystartują między innymi Jonas Davidsson i bracia Gomólscy.

Bilety na turniej kosztują odpowiednio 15 zł (trybuna główna) i 10 zł (pozostałe sektory). Aktualna lista startowa zawodów liczy 12 zawodników. W obsadzie pojawią się jeszcze żużlowcy z ENEA Ekstraligi. Początek zawodów zaplanowano na godzinę 16:00.

which translates to:-

October 11 at the track in Gniezno tournament will be held, which will end the season speedway in the city. The event will start among other things, Jonas Davidsson and brothers Gomólscy.
Tournament Tickets are priced at 15 zł (main grandstand) and 10 zł (other sectors). The current list of occupations page consists of 12 players. The cast appear even speedway with ENEA Extraleague. The beginning of the competition is scheduled for 16:00 hour.

Lodz are def at home to Czestochowa on Sunday-confirmation here http://speedwayekstraliga.pl/wp-content/uploads/2014/04/Komunikat-Enea-Ekstraligi-nr-60_2014.pdf

However no start time quoted

Edit think this whole play-off fixture in doubt

Google translation of Sportowefakty article

 

Eagle boat is not going to give awizowanego composition on the first play-off matches, because he believes that this meeting should take place on 19 and not 12 October.

 

- We will not give any awizowanego composition on the first leg qualifier. First, the oral conversations GKSŻ members were convinced that the first play-off is October 19. This information also bore on Extraleague and today it has been changed. However, we did keep the screenshots on your computer club and on the basis of well see how it all along the way changed. I do not understand what this is all about and why someone wants to suddenly make the first play-off October 12 - said in the pink portal SportoweFakty.pl Witold Skrzydlewski.

 

 

 

 

 

 

 

Recall that the Eagle has already announced that he will not go in the playoffs if they do not receive support from the outside. As emphasized by the president Skrzydlewski, was about EUR 250 thousand. On Thursday, is about to take place special press conference at which the club Lodz inform its decision in relation to the competition in the play-offs. According to our information, the team Witold Skrzydlewskiego maintains its earlier position and decided not to participate in these meetings. The main sponsor of the Eagle criticizes the Polish authorities slag. Skrzydlewski believes that they have introduced significant confusion around the deadlines for play-off games.

 

Screenshots made ​​by Eagle:

-> Calendar on page PZM

-> Calendar for the PZM (as amended)

-> Calendar Leagues International

 

- The calendar of international events also bears the date October 19. Mistakes have to be too Speedway in Calendar year 2014 turns out that mistakes were everywhere? This is getting ridiculous. I think it is already a mockery. Now all of a sudden changed. Once again, I believe that you should report to the Minister of Sport, to see what is going on in Polish shale. It is after all a total mess. You can not change the deadlines as you want. The case is for us so much simpler that previously advertised that riding on Extraliga does not interest us. From one of the representatives of this company, I heard that a club like ours would lower the image of the tournament. When he talked to me yesterday, it's still politely discussed the October 19 deadline. Today, everything has changed. I do not know what it is. Scared that but go these playoffs? - Asks Skrzydlewski.
